Gartan is a character in Breath of the Wild.[2]

Biography[]

Gartan is a Hylian Merchant that can be found traveling on foot in the Gerudo Desert.[3] He carries a Wooden Shield and a Traveler's Sword as he travels between Gerudo Canyon Stable and the entrance to Gerudo Town. Along the way, he passes through Kara Kara Bazaar.

Gartan is very interested in Gerudo women.[4][5][6][7] He is very defensive of this, claiming that business is his top priority.[8] He is disappointed that he is not allowed to move into Gerudo Town.[9]

Gartan enjoys being a Merchant because it gives him an excuse to talk to the Gerudo.[10] At Kara Kara Bazaar, Gartan is excited about making small talk with the Gerudo there.[11] Gartan then says that it is just part of his job to make friends and asks Link if he wants some Apples.[12] However, he admits that he gets nervous around Gerudo ladies.[13]

While Divine Beast Vah Naboris is still active, Gartan reveals that it makes traveling to Gerudo Town from Kara Kara Bazaar dangerous.[14] However, he refuses to let it stop him from meeting Gerudo ladies.[15] He is also very worried about the presence of thieves in Gerudo Town.[16]

Gartan considers the term "wasteland" to be accurate when describing the Gerudo Desert, as there are many monsters and sandstorms.[17] However, he does not know how else someone is supposed to meet Gerudo women.[1][18]

Gartan can also be found at the Gerudo Canyon Stable, where he tells Link that he wishes more Gerudo ladies would come by.[19][20] Gartan sometimes mutters about his determination to get into Gerudo Town and get close to the ladies.[21] When he notices Link listening, he tells him that he was just muttering about "important business secrets."[22]

Gartan journeyed to Gerudo Town to get to know the Gerudo better, but he did not find out men were not allowed until he got there.[23] Link can catch Gartan muttering to himself that there must be a way into the Town.[24] When Gartan notices that Link is listening, he is startled and nervously explains that he was just thinking out loud to nobody.[25][26]

If Link saves Gartan from monsters, he may say how close of a save it was to himself.[27] He considers the only thing scarier than monsters to be Gerudo women.[28] His strategy for surviving attacks is to run away.[29] He gives Link Rupees for saving him.[30]

Link can buy Items from Gartan.[31] He thanks Link for his purchases.[32][33] When Linkbuys all of one of his products, he apologizes that he has run out.[34] He is grateful for Link's business when all of his stock is bought out.[35]

In addition to selling his wares, Gartan will also purchase Items from Link.[36][37][38][39] He is appreciative of the products he is able to buy,[40] and he asks if Link has more for him.[41]
